biouml.plugins.simulation.java
Class RunTimeCompiler

java.lang.Object
  extended bybiouml.plugins.simulation.java.RunTimeCompiler

public class RunTimeCompiler
extends java.lang.Object

Class to compile generated Java models.


Nested Class Summary
static class RunTimeCompiler.ErrorOutputStream
           
 
Field Summary
protected  java.lang.String classpath
           
protected  java.lang.String[] files
           
protected static java.lang.Object javac
           
static org.apache.log4j.Category log
           
protected  java.lang.String outDir
           
protected  RunTimeCompiler.ErrorOutputStream outStream
           
protected  java.lang.String srcDir
           
 
Constructor Summary
RunTimeCompiler(java.lang.String classpath, java.lang.String srcDir, java.lang.String[] files)
           
 
Method Summary
 boolean execute()
          Use introspection to not include javac into build classpath.
 java.lang.String[] getArguments()
           
 java.lang.String getClasspath()
           
 java.lang.String[] getFiles()
           
 java.lang.String getMessages()
           
 java.lang.String getOutDir()
           
 java.lang.String getSrcDir()
           
 void setClasspath(java.lang.String classpath)
           
 void setFiles(java.lang.String[] files)
           
 void setOutDir(java.lang.String outDir)
           
 void setSrcDir(java.lang.String srcDir)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

log

public static org.apache.log4j.Category log

javac

protected static java.lang.Object javac

classpath

protected java.lang.String classpath

srcDir

protected java.lang.String srcDir

outDir

protected java.lang.String outDir

files

protected java.lang.String[] files

outStream

protected RunTimeCompiler.ErrorOutputStream outStream
Constructor Detail

RunTimeCompiler

public RunTimeCompiler(java.lang.String classpath,
                       java.lang.String srcDir,
                       java.lang.String[] files)
Method Detail

getClasspath

public java.lang.String getClasspath()

setClasspath

public void setClasspath(java.lang.String classpath)

getSrcDir

public java.lang.String getSrcDir()

setSrcDir

public void setSrcDir(java.lang.String srcDir)

getOutDir

public java.lang.String getOutDir()

setOutDir

public void setOutDir(java.lang.String outDir)

getFiles

public java.lang.String[] getFiles()

setFiles

public void setFiles(java.lang.String[] files)

getArguments

public java.lang.String[] getArguments()

execute

public boolean execute()
Use introspection to not include javac into build classpath.


getMessages

public java.lang.String getMessages()


Copyright © 2001-2003 Biosof.Ru. All Rights Reserved.